WebJul 13, 2016 · Fluorescent. Fluorescent light ceiling fans use compact fluorescent light bulbs (CFL) and use 75% less energy than incandescent lights. Fluorescent light bulbs have a longer lifespan than halogen bulbs, but not as long as LEDs. WebDec 9, 2024 · LED track lights save on energy costs, are cool to the touch and the light is less damaging to artwork. In general, consider the following: Warm white color temperature for living rooms and bedrooms. Bright white color temperature for kitchens and workspaces. Daylight color temperature for reading nooks and studies. The CFL can also be used in an ... mth it serviceWebFeb 8, 2024 · Flush Mount/Semi-Flush Mount Lighting Size. The size for the flush mount or semi-flush mount light that you need depends on the size of your space. The average flush mount light is 13 inches wide, but they range from 12 inches to 24 inches wide. Semi-flush mount lights can range from 6-1/4 inches to 23 inches wide. mthiyane clanWebJun 1, 2024 · 2. Pendant Lights. Pendant fixtures hang down from the ceiling by a cord, cable, or chain.
